Why does gravity keep us on Earth but let birds fly?

Gravity is like a big invisible rope that pulls everything toward Earth, including you and me!

How gravity works

Imagine you're playing with a ball on a string. When you swing it around, the string keeps the ball from flying away. Gravity is like that string, it keeps us from floating off into space. But why don’t birds float away too?

Why birds can fly

Birds have something special: wings! Think of wings like tiny fans that push air down when a bird flaps them. That pushes the bird up, just like how you jump higher when you push the ground down with your feet.

So gravity pulls birds down, but their wings help them push up, and that’s enough to make them fly! It’s like being on a seesaw: one side goes down while the other goes up. Birds are good at balancing that pull from gravity with their strong wing flaps.
